If you are trying to burn a video DVD, not just a data DVD, why don't you just let iDVD do it? Read the docs for how to use iDVD.

I'm writing in os9 at the moment so I can't give you exact instructions for iMovie 3 and iDVD 3.

Basically, you EXPORT your video from iMovie in a format iDVD recognizes.   Use the 
EXPORT menu item, it will tell you which format to use for iDVD.  In some versions it 
will actually run iDVD and load the file into it for you.  If not drag the files onto 
an iDVD project window.  Ths represents the DVD menu that will appear on your tv 
screen.  There are a million fun ways (styles) to set this menu up.  Read the help 
files.

iDVD will encode the files and burn the DVD for you. This may take hours but you can 
check the progress in the status menu.   You can choose burn before the movies are 
compressed, or while they are being compressed.  It will finish the encoding job if 
necessary, then burn the DVD. That's really all there is to it.  You don't need any 
temporary partitions or anything.  Your 120 gig drive is plenty big enough unless you 
are working on a lot of video projects at one time.

Use Toast only to burn data DVDs or to copy finished video DVDs.
